 as part of Quantum Optics and Related Topics\n\n\nAbstract\nNitrogen-vacan
 cy (NV) centers are color-defects in the diamond crystal lattice which hav
 e raised a lot of attention in the last decades for their promising sensin
 g capabilities (especially for magnetic field and temperature)\, based on 
 spin-dependent photoluminescence. Moreover\, diamond biocompatibility and 
 good sensitivity at room temperature naturally lead to biological applicat
 ions. Both bulk diamond and nanodiamonds can be used in this context\, eac
 h presenting its own advantages and challenges.\n\nIn this presentation\, 
 I’ll describe our recent results in both directions. On one side I'll di
 scuss how diamond chips can be nanostructured and used as substrates for c
 ellular growth. On the other\, I'll show how nanodiamonds can be used for 
 nanoscale thermometry inside cells. Both approaches can be combined with e
 xisting measurements techniques and give new insights on many biological p
 rocesses which are still not completely understood.\n
